带压开采矿井导水断层探查与治理技术 被引量:18

Inspection and Control Technology for Mine Water Conductive Fault Mining Under Pressure
原文传递
导出
摘要 棋盘井煤矿主采16#煤层,掘进期间遇DF1、DF3断层,受到煤层底板奥灰水突水威胁。井田范围内16#煤层与奥陶系灰岩的平均间距为38.72 m,最高带压1.9 MPa。以此为例,提出了断层探查、泄压引流及靶面帷幕注浆治理方案。通过探放水及治理工程的实施,确保了导水断层带的掘进安全。 Qipanjing Coal Mine,which mainly mines the 16#coal seam,is threatened by ordovician limestone water hazard. During the roadway excavation,DF1 and DF3faults are founded. The average distance between 16#coal seam and ordovician limestone is about38. 72 m. After calculation,mining the 16#coal seam would be under 1. 9 MPa water pressure. Plans for faults detection,dewatering and target surface curtain grouting are presented and conducted to make sure that the roadways near fault zone are safely excavated.
